Socks Posted May 2, 2016 Author Share Posted May 2, 2016 Sounds ace, hows the gearing compare between C and E series? Any longer or about the same? Good tbh Morg. The E153 is much nicer in terms of feel/synchro/throw. etc Compared to a C52. On the chart I left the ratios and rpm limit the same as a 4e. Then added the 8k limiter its at now at the end. Ratios are a touch longer, which is what you want really for high power. 5th gear is much nicer when cruising! Much more choice in the E series box in terms of gears so! Speed sensors front and rear style setup?Sounds goodPhil Well spotted Mr Eagle Eyes.No and Yes.As far as I understand it there are some basic settings in the launch control options on DTA. Giving it the ability to limit revs in 1st gear until a certain speed is reached.Its actually set a touch too low atm in my opinion. But we haven't even delved into it enough yet. We didnt know what traction would be like. Clearly its better then we first thought. Your much less likely to spin unloading 320bhp at 10mph then at 0mph, is the theory behind it all, and clearly it does work. Sounds a bit like a boxer, lovely Un-Equal Length Manifold.
